How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hope?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hope Studio Apartments | $2,021 | $1,700 | $2,450 |
| Hope 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,608 | $1,345 | $2,000 |
| Hope 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,164 | $1,675 | $2,800 |
| Hope 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,782 | $1,750 | $5,500 |
| Hope 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,050 | $2,900 | $3,250 |

Getting Around the Hope Neighborhood in Providence, RI
Walk Score®
86 / 100
Very Walkable
Most err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
56 / 100
Bikeable
Some b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
46 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
